The FMV Industry Night: connecting graduates with industry leaders
![](https://flandersmetalsvalley.be/app/uploads/2024/12/1-300x0-c-default.jpg)
Last week, we organised a splendid FMV Industry Night, where graduates at KU Leuven could connect with industry leaders. About 50 students registered for this event, while we had energetic speeches from our members.
First off, Steffen Robert from EIT Raw Materials kicked off by presenting the Tapojärvi Open Innovation Challenge 2025, for (chemical) engineering student, metallurgy students and forest industry students who want to make a positive environmental impact. Certainly it was an appealing call, with a first prize consisting of a 10 000 euro cash prize and the chance to work within the Tapojärvi group, the Finnish forerunner in industrial circular economy.
Next was Rui Gao from Vito, who had a compelling speech about her path from the Beijing University, going to Harvard University for a postdoctoral fellowship, and finally to her final stop (for now) as a researcher for Vito. Her story was met with a lot of enthousiasm from the students as she is a great example of an international academic career.
Wouter Crijns from ResourceFull was next. As a graduate from KU Leuven, he is now a visionary entrepreneur. He inspired and challenged the students, as he explained his vision for a climate solution, and the role his company plays in it. ResourceFull is a specialist in researching low impact concrete solutions, with many of their solutions already implemented in the industry.
Elise Venken and Manuel Vissers were the last to take the stage. Together with their HR colleagues from Aurubis, they gave us an insight in their daily lives at this titan of the industry. Though recently graduated, it is clear that they can achieve greatness at Aurubis, where they are well taken care off.
After the speeches, we were invited to talk with the speakers over drinks and snacks. The discussions were lively and there was plenty of interest in the companies, their values and their opportunities. As a recruitment event, as a publicity forum or simply as an interesting evening with peers, it was a successful evening on all fronts.
